Overview
The SmaRT OO-218-DIS Handheld Remote is a robust, 18-button device utilizing 2.4GHz DSSS technology for a 300ft. line-of-sight communication range with a SmaRT base unit. It features a two-line LCD display with adjustable backlight and contrast, housed in a durable enclosure made of high-impact polymer, polycarbonate, and stainless steel.

Specifications
  • Power: Two 9V alkaline batteries with auto-shutdown after 30 seconds of inactivity.
  • Environment: Operating and storage temperature range from -20°C to 55°C, with 0 to 100% humidity tolerance.
  • Display: 2-line LCD, 8 characters per line, with adjustable backlight and contrast.
  • Radio: Frequency range of 2405-2480MHz, 2mW RF power, DSSS modulation, internal antenna, and license-free operation.
  • Enclosure: Dimensions of 9 ⅛” x 3 ⅛” x 1 ¼”, weighing 15.2 oz., with high-impact polymer and stainless steel faceplates.
  • Control Functions: One ON, one OFF, and sixteen function buttons, with a typical button life of 5 million operations.

Association Procedure
To establish communication between the handheld remote and the base unit, the Association process is required. This involves:
  1. Removing power from the base unit and turning off the handheld.
  2. Standing near the base unit with a clear line-of-sight.
  3. Pressing and holding the ON button and button 12 until ASSOC ACTIVE displays.
  4. Releasing the buttons and pressing button 1 to power up the base unit, completing the association.

Backlight and Contrast Adjustment
Adjustments can be made while the base unit is powered down to avoid inadvertent commands:
  • Contrast: Increased by pressing ON and button 13, decreased by pressing ON and button 16.
  • Backlighting: Increased by pressing ON and button 11, decreased by pressing ON and button 14.

System Information Review
System information such as base unit messages per second, channel, handheld ID, base unit ID, and battery voltage can be reviewed by pressing ON and button 9 simultaneously.

Engineering SpecSheet SmaRT 00-218-DIS Handheld Remote Features s 2.4GHz Spread Spectrum Technology s 300ft. (100m) Line-of-Sight Range s 18-Button Control s Two Line LCD Display with Backlight and Contrast Control s LED Indicators s Rugged High-Impact Polymer/Polycarbonate/Stainless Steel Enclosure s Weatherproof Design Powered by Two 9V Batteries The SmaRT OO-218-DIS Handheld Remote is an 18-button handheld remote using 2.4GHz DSSS technology to provide a 300ft. line-of-sight handheld-to-base unit communication range. The handheld has 18-button allowing ON/OFF and custom factory configuration of up to 16-function control of a SmaRT base unit. The two-line display provides instant verification of control activity. The adjustable backlight and contrast allows for user control of power consumption. The unit enclosure is constructed of rugged high-impact polymer with a polycarbonate faceplate on the display. A stainless steel faceplate is securely attached to provide additional ruggedness. Using Direct Sequence Spread Spectrum (DSSS) wireless technology at 2.4GHz, the handheld provides a robust link in congested radio environments with a variety of SmaRT base units including the powerful BU-916F. SmaRT handheld remotes feature seamless association to SmaRT base units without the need to open either the handheld or base unit case. Engineering SpecSheet Association Communication between the handheld remote and base unit must be established before the system can be used. This link process is called Association and it is performed while the handheld remote is in Associate Mode. Association between remote and base unit is established at the factory; however, there may be instances in the field when a handheld remote and a base unit must be re-associated.
